Dr Allen Sammy, chairman of the Penal/Debe Regional Corporation, said flooding in areas under the corporation began at the Dabiedial Road Junction, and all four major junctions along the Penal Rock Road were also affected.
The Office of Disaster Preparedness and Management (ODPM) reported a series of incidents caused by the yellow-level weather alert on Tuesday. There was one reported incident in the north-west region where a tree fell in Upper Santa Cruz at Sam Boucaud.
Members of the disaster management unit (DMU) of the Penal/Debe Regional Corporation spent hours helping burgesses affected by the flooding on Thursday evening and Friday, said the corporation’s chairman.
